Application Notes

Applications must be submitted on the new Z83 form, which can be downloaded at http://www.dpsa.gov.za/dpsa2g/vacancies.asp. Applications submitted on the old application for employment (Z83) will not be considered. All fields in the Z83 application form must be completed in full, in a manner that allows a selection committee to assess the quality of a candidate based on the information provided in the form. It is therefore prudent that fields be completed by applicants and the form must be signed noting the importance of the declaration. South African applicants need not provide passport numbers. Candidates must respond “yes” or “no” to the question “Are you conducting business with the State or are you a Director of a Public or Private company conducting business with the State? If “yes”, details thereof must be attached to the application. It is acceptable for an applicant to indicate “not applicable” or leave blank to the question “In the event that you are employed in the Public Service, will you immediately relinquish such business interest?”. Applicants are not required to submit copies of qualifications and other relevant documents on application but must submit the completed and signed Z83 and a detailed Curriculum Vitae. The communication from HR of the Department regarding the requirements for certified document will be limited to shortlisted candidates. Therefore, only shortlisted candidates for a post will be required to submit certified documents on or before the day of the interview following communication from HR.

Foreign qualifications must be accompanied by an evaluation report issued by SAQA. It is the applicant’s responsibility to have all foreign qualifications evaluated by SAQA and to provide proof of such evaluation report (only when shortlisted). Should you not hear from the Department within three (3) months of the closing date of this advertisement, please consider your application to be unsuccessful. The Department reserves the right not to fill and/or make an appointment to any of the advertised posts. The applicant should not have previously served as an intern or contract worker in the Public Service and must not be older than 35 years. Applicants who participated on the internship programme in the past will be disqualified. All shortlisted candidates will be subject to personal security vetting. Note that in terms of the Protection of Personal Information Act, 2021, the Department will ensure the protection of applicants’ personal information and will only collect, use, and retain applicants’ personal information for the purposes of recruitment and selection processes. The Department shall safeguard such personal information against access by unauthorised persons, unlawful disclosure, or breaches. The Department of Women, Youth, and Persons with Disabilities is an equal opportunity employer. In the filling of these posts, the objectives of section 195 of the Constitution of the Republic of South Africa and the Employment Equity Act, 1998 (Act 55 of 1998) will be taken into consideration and preference will be given to Youth and Persons with Disabilities.
